Mac OS X Lion 10.7.2 build 11C71 released by Apple

      During last evening Apple has launched build 11C71 of Mac OS X Lion for application developers for Mac OS X. This new beta version of the operating system is part of a long line of builds designed to bring users many bug fixes, some new features and improvements to the performance of the operating system. In this beta version, Apple announces that it will solve the problems with Find My Mac and the introduction of a password for the firmware, but there are also improvements to the way Lion Recovery works.

     Mac OS X Lion 10.7.2 build 11C71 is available for Mac OS X application developers in their dedicated portal on the Apple website. This could be the last beta version of Mac OS X Lion 10.7.2 before the official release that could happen with iOS 5 and iCloud next week.
